As we age, staying active becomes increasingly important for maintaining physical health and emotional well-being. Here are seven essential tips for seniors to keep in mind.
Before diving into any fitness routine, it’s crucial to start slowly. Begin with gentle exercises to gauge your body’s response and gradually increase the intensity.
Strength training helps maintain muscle mass and bone density. Aim for at least two sessions per week using resistance bands or light weights.
Flexibility is key to maintaining mobility. Incorporate stretching exercises into your routine to improve joint health and overall flexibility.
Choose activities that you genuinely enjoy, whether it’s dancing, walking, or swimming. Enjoyment can motivate you to stay active consistently.
Exercise doesn’t have to be a solo activity. Joining groups or classes can provide social interaction, which is beneficial for mental health.
Pay attention to how your body feels during and after exercise. It’s essential to rest and recover as needed to avoid injuries.
Set achievable goals that reflect your fitness level and lifestyle. Small, realistic goals can lead to significant improvements over time.
Incorporating these tips into your routine can lead to a healthier, more active lifestyle. Remember to consult with a healthcare professional before starting any new exercise program.
